Linux基本网络配置

实验案例一:设置服务器的网络参数

实验环境

公司新购置了一台服务器,并安装了rhel5操作系统。现在需要为该服务器正确配置网络参数,以便正常接入公司局域网。

需求描述

1)、将eth0网卡的ip地址设置为192.168.2.10,子网掩码设置为255.255.255.0,默认网关地址设置为192.168.2.1。

2)、将服务器的主机名称设置为dataserver.benet.com。

3)、将服务器使用的dns服务器地址设置为192.168.2.5、202.106.0.20,默认搜索域为benet.com。

4)、添加添加打印服务器、文件服务器的主机名->ip地址映射记录:prtsvr的ip地址为192.168.2.3、filesvr的ip地址为192.168.2.4。

推荐步骤

1)、编辑文件“/etc/sysconfig/network-scripts/ifcfg-eth0”,依次配置项ipaddr、netmask及gateway。

Linux基本网络配置

2)、编辑文件“/etc/sysconfig/network”,修改配置项HOSTNAME。

Linux基本网络配置

3)、编辑文件“/etc/resolv.conf”,修改search配置项,并添加nameserver配置项。

Linux基本网络配置

4)、修改文件“/etc/hosts”,添加两行主机名称解析记录。

Linux基本网络配置

5)、确定并保存上述配置后,重新启动服务器。使上述的配置文件生效。

实验案例二:构建dhcp及dhcp中继服务器

实验环境

公司内部网络划分三个物理网段,并通过一台Linux网关服务器相互连接。为了提供集中化的地址分配管理,现需要构建一台DHCP服务器,在不增加硬件投资的情况下,为处于不同网段的客户机动态配置ip地址等网络参数。

Linux基本网络配置

需求描述

1)、在Linux网关服务器中开启路由转发,并配置启用DHCP中继服务。

2)、在192.168.1.0/24网段中构建一台DHCP服务器,ip地址为192.168.1.2。能够为192.168.1.0/24、192.168.2.0./24、192.168.3.0/24网段中的客户机自动分配ip地址等网络参数。

3)、为个客户机动态分配的ip地址,默认租约时间设为21600秒,最大租约时间为43200秒。

4)、为各客户机设置使用的dns服务器地址为202.106.0.20、202.106.148.1。

5)、对应于3个物理网段,用于动态分配的ip地址范围分别为:192.168.1.20~192.168.1.200、192.168.2.20 ~192.168.2.200、192.168.3.20~192.168.3.200。

6)、个网段中客户机的默认网关地址使用DHCP中继服务器在该网段内的接口ip地址。

实验用各机网络配置

机器 网卡 ip地址 虚拟网卡

DHCP服务器 eth0 192.168.1.2/24 vmnet3

eth0 192.168.1.1/24 vmnet3

DHCP中继 eth1 192.168.2.1/24 vmnet4

eth2 192.168.3.1/24 vmnet5

测试客户机 eth0 自动获得 vmnet3~4切换

推荐步骤

1)、确认网络地址正确

为DHCP服务器、DHCP中继服务器正确听见网卡设备并配置各接口的ip地址等参数,注意要将DHCP服务器的默认网关地址为192.168.1.1,以便与内网客户机通讯。

Linux基本网络配置

Linux基本网络配置

2)、配置DHCP服务器

确认DHCP软件包已经安装。

Linux基本网络配置

修改配置文件。

Linux基本网络配置

启动服务。

Linux基本网络配置

3)、配置DHCP中继服务器

确认DHCP软件包已经安装。

Linux基本网络配置

编辑“/etc/sysconfig/dhcrelay”,设置好网络接口及DHCP服务器地址。

Linux基本网络配置

启动dhcrelay服务。

Linux基本网络配置

开启路由转发功能。

Linux基本网络配置

4)、验证。

在客户机上一次切换网卡,确认接收到ip地址。

使用vmnet3获取到ip地址。

Linux基本网络配置

使用vmnet4获取到ip地址。

Linux基本网络配置

使用vmnet5获取到的ip地址。

Linux基本网络配置